0

10 個のディレクトリにシェル スクリプトを作成しました。

a/we.sh
b/we.sh
c/we.sh
.
.
.
.

unix/Linux のすべてのディレクトリでシェル スクリプトの変更を更新する方法。

4

2 に答える 2

2

シンボリックリンク機能を利用できます。作成したすべてのファイルでコマンドを使用しlnます。このようにして、1 つのファイルを変更すると、リンクされたすべてのパスに表示されます。シンボリック リンクを作成するには、この簡単なコマンドを使用できますln -s script.sh sample.shsample.sh作成されるパスは次のとおりです。

于 2013-06-11T10:58:46.690 に答える
1

使用できます

find . -iname 'we.sh' -type f -exec cp '/path/to/modified/script/we.sh {} \;
于 2013-06-11T11:21:20.893 に答える